India: Modi announces repeal of controversial farm laws

Over a year of protests pays off for Indian farmers. Modi has announced he will repeal the farm laws that started the waves of protests. This might be because the unpopular laws made his party unelectable in some rural regions that faces local elections soon.

Government produce boards are a tricky issue. When producers are low on literacy and some only have tiny amounts to sell, boards are definitely the best. However when there's an export market, boards serve the domestic market (keeping prices down, good for consumers, bad for producers) reducing the total return and giving a boon to foreign buyers. India with simple production methods turns out surpluses or deficits of any one product, year by year. They should make the boards smarter, guarantee board prices to all farmers, while also allowing premium producers to sell directly to foreign markets. Of course it's not easy, but maybe next time mr. Modhi?
